Brownsville Locksmith Licensing: Beyond the TXDPS Bureau to Google's Trust Signals

While the Texas Department of Public Safety (TXDPS) Private Security Bureau oversees locksmith licensing in Texas, ensuring professional standards, Google's algorithm interprets trust differently for Brownsville searches. For a 'locksmith Brownsville' query, Google prioritizes E-E-A-T signals that extend beyond a state license number displayed in fine print. Schema markup, specifically `LocalBusiness` and `Locksmith` types with `hasCredential` pointing to the TXDPS Private Security Bureau, is crucial yet often absent. Furthermore, consistent NAP (Name, Address, Phone) data across Brownsville-specific citations like the Brownsville Chamber of Commerce directory and local BBB listings significantly bolsters local authority. The top-ranking Brownsville locksmith sites leverage these signals, demonstrating not just licensure, but active community engagement and verifiable customer satisfaction, which Google translates into higher ranking potential for emergency lockout searches near the Port of Brownsville or in the city's downtown core.

Brownsville Locksmith Website Mistakes: Losing Leads from South Padre Island to Rancho Viejo

Many Brownsville locksmith websites make critical errors that actively repel potential clients. First, neglecting mobile responsiveness means sites appear broken or unnavigable on smartphones, where the majority of emergency lockout searches originate. Second, slow page load speeds, often exceeding three seconds, cause 40% of users to abandon a site, directly impacting lead generation for services like rekeying or lock repair. Third, a lack of clear, above-the-fold calls to action, such as a prominent 'Call Now' button, forces distressed users to search for contact information, adding friction to an urgent situation. Fourth, failing to implement Brownsville-specific schema markup for services and location prevents Google from accurately understanding and ranking the site for local intent. Addressing these foundational issues is paramount for any Brownsville locksmith aiming to capture leads from the entire service area, from South Padre Island to Rancho Viejo, and beyond.
